New program aims to ease burden for Veterans' caregivers
NCT ID NCT03397667
Summary
This study tested a one-year support program for Veterans diagnosed with Alzheimer's disease or traumatic brain injury and their family caregivers. The program aimed to improve the quality of life for both the Veteran and the caregiver while reducing the stress and burden felt by the caregiver. It was compared against standard primary care to see if the extra support made a difference.
